What are the seven phases of the strengths-based therapy model?

What will be an ideal response?


Creating a therapeutic alliance, strengths discovery, eliciting clients’ hopes and dreams, framing solutions and formulating a treatment plan, building strengths and competence, building a healthy new identity and reanchoring of the self, and evaluating and terminating counseling.
